In my opinion, the all time TD passes is the best way to truly judge what a qb has done on the field. High passer ratings......the qb may have worked sideline to sideline and not got the ball into the endzone. The most wins can mean the qb had the better defense, the most losses a qb has suffered could mean the qb had no defense or teamates. By judging a qb by touchdown passes, it shows he was able to get the ball into the endzone and at the end of the day, I think that is the most important thing.. Or maybe better yet, they should create a stat, if there isn't one already( Sonny??)that shows how many drives the qb had that ended in a td.......................so 10 td's in 10 drives is greater than 10 td's in 20 drives......
